What is a Casino Aggregator?
A Casino Jackpot Aggregator aggregator is a B2B innovation platform that bridges the gap in between online casino operators and game designers (companies). Rather of an operator integrating every game studio individually-- a process that includes complex coding, separate contract negotiations, distinct legal frameworks, and ongoing technical maintenance-- the operator integrates when with a casino aggregator.
Through a single API (Application Programming Interface), the aggregator grants the operator instant access to a huge portfolio of games from lots, or perhaps hundreds, of different material providers.
How Does a Casino Aggregator Work?
To comprehend the mechanics, one can picture the aggregator as an enormous digital wholesale marketplace.
- The Provider Side: Software designers (like NetEnt, Pragmatic Play, or Evolution Gaming) connect their game servers to the aggregator's center.
- The Aggregator Hub: The aggregator standardizes the information, formats the APIs, manages currencies, handles cryptocurrency conversions, and makes sure compliance requirements are fulfilled.
- The Operator Side: The online casino links to the aggregator. When a player clicks a Slot Games Aggregator game on the casino site, the command is routed through the aggregator, which pulls the game content directly from the supplier's server in real-time.
Why Operators Rely on Aggregators: Key Benefits
Incorporating games via an aggregator offers numerous unique tactical and monetary advantages for online casino operators.
1. Speed to Market
Structure individual integrations can take weeks or months per supplier. An aggregator enables a brand-new casino brand name to introduce with a portfolio of thousands of video games in a matter of days.
2. Cost Efficiency
Handling multiple direct contracts needs substantial legal, accounting, and technical resources. Aggregators combine billing and technical support, significantly reducing overhead costs.
3. Simplified Back-Office Management
Instead of logging into numerous provider dashboards to examine game efficiency, manage gamer conflicts, or set up benefits, operators utilize the aggregator's merged back-office system.
4. Scalability
As an online casino grows and desires to add specific niche developers or trending new mechanics, the aggregator can release these additions immediately without interfering with the existing platform architecture.

Not all aggregators are produced equivalent. When assessing a platform, operators usually search for the following functions:
- Extansive Game Portfolio: A mix of slots, table video games, live casino, and virtual sports from top-tier and shop studios.
- Robust API Documentation: Clean, developer-friendly APIs that ensure minimal downtime and fast response times.
- Multi-Currency and Crypto Support: The ability to handle fiat currencies, e-wallets, and cryptocurrencies flawlessly.
- Regulatory Compliance: Games and platforms licensed by acknowledged testing laboratories (e.g., eCOGRA, iTech Labs) and certified in essential jurisdictions.
- Advertising Tools: Built-in gamification tools like competitions, totally free spins engines, and jackpot modules that operators can use across all aggregated video games.
The Future of Casino Aggregation
As the iGaming industry continues to progress, casino aggregators are likewise adapting. Numerous trends are shaping the future of aggregation:
- AI-Driven Personalization: Aggregators are starting to use artificial intelligence to assist operators customize game recommendations based upon private gamer habits.
- Immediate Crypto Settlements: Smart contracts and blockchain technology are being integrated to speed up financial reconciliation between operators and service providers.
- Micro-Services Architecture: Modern aggregators are moving toward modular systems, enabling operators to choose particular functions instead of adopting a monolithic software bundle.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Are casino aggregators game developers?
No. Normally, Casino Jackpot Aggregator aggregators do not develop their own games. They function as distributors, licensing material from third-party studios and packaging it for online casinos. Nevertheless, some big aggregators do have internal studio subsidiaries.
2. Do casino aggregators affect game RTP (Return to Player)?
No. The RTP of a game is hardcoded by the game developer and certified by independent screening laboratories. The aggregator merely transfers the game data and can not alter the mathematics or chances of a game.
3. How do casino aggregators earn money?
Aggregators usually run on a Revenue Share (RevShare) design. They take a little percentage of the Gross Gaming Revenue (GGR) produced by the games they provide, or they may charge setup fees and monthly platform upkeep costs alongside a lower revenue share.
4. Can players access casino aggregators straight?
No. Casino aggregators run on a Business-to-Business (B2B) model. They do decline gamers or run public websites. Gamers interact specifically with the Business-to-Consumer (B2C) online casino operators.
